c语言String字符串函数探幽 字符串函数探幽 字符串函数位于头文件string.h中,该文件包含字符串常用函数:strlen()、strcat()、strcmp()、strncmp()、strcpy()、strncpy()和sprintf()函数。 1、strlen()函数 1、用于得到字符串的长度。 函数原型size_t __cdecl strlen(const char *_Str);,函数接收一个字符串的...
【C语言】<string.h>中十大字符串函数(用法+模拟实现) 清隆 你所在的地方,总会成为你的跑道。——田崎先生 3 人赞同了该文章 个人认为头文件中常用字符串函数一共有十大,学习完本篇文章,字符串数据处理轻松拿下。 零. 贯穿全文的前言 关于字符串最重要的知识点: C语言本身是没有字符串类型的,字符串...
#include<stdio.h>#include<string.h>intmain(){intarr1[10]={0};intarr2[10]={1,2,3,4,5,6,7,8,9,10};memmove(arr1,arr2,4*sizeof(arr2[0]));printf("arr1:");for(inti=0;i<10;i++)printf("%d ",arr1[i]);printf("\narr2:");for(inti=0;i<10;i++)printf("%d ",arr2...
函数原型: void*memcpy(void*dest,constvoid*src,size_t n); 用法: 可与用于转移数据 //1.整数型inta=4,b=10;memcpy(&a,&b,sizeof(b));cout<<a;//output:10//2.结构体类型structstudent{string name;intnum;}a;a={"xiaoming",18};structteacher{string name;intnum;}b;b={"laowang",40};mem...
<C> 字符串相关的函数 一.strlen 1.头文件:#include<string.h> 2.返回值:(无符号int)字符串长度 3.作用:计算字符串的长度 4.与sizeof的区分:sizeof是求大小的 这里用一道例题来说明 1#include<stdio.h>2#include<string.h>34intmain()5{6charstr1[] ="abcde";7inta = strlen(str1);//58intb ...
C语言的string.h头文件提供了一系列函数和工具,用于对字符串进行操作和处理。这些函数包括字符串复制、连接、比较、查找等功能,为开发人员提供了强大的字符串处理能力。本文将对string.h头文件中的所有函数进行全面介绍,包括它们的功能和使用方法,以帮助大家更好地理解和利用该头文件。
C语言头文件string.h中包含了一系列函数,用于操作字符串。下面是一些常用的函数及其功能解释: strlen(const char *str): 返回字符串的长度,不包括结尾的空字符(‘\0’)。 strcpy(char *dest, const char *src): 将源字符串src复制到目标字符串dest中,包括结尾的空字符(‘\0’)。 strncpy(char *dest, ...
c语言string函数 标准C 语言的string.h头文件中定义了一组有用的函数,被称为字符串处理函数。字符串就是由字母,数字和符号组成的一行字符序列,通常以字符串结尾显示。它是一种数据抽象,是用来存储,分析,表示和处理应用程序中的文本数据的一种常见方式。 1.strlen()函数:该函数用来计算字符串的长度,不包括字符串...
在C语言中,可以使用string.h头文件中的函数来操作字符串。以下是一些常用的函数及其使用方法:1. strcpy(char *dest, const char *src):将字符串src复制到...
头文件 <string.h> 定义了一个变量类型、一个宏和两组字符串函数,一组函数的名字以str开头,还有一组函数的名字以mem开头。 1、一个变量类型 size_t:无符号整型(unsigned int),是sizeof操作符返回的结果类型,在64位系统中为 long unsigned int。 代码示例 运行结果 其中,%zu 用来输出 size_t 类型。 2、一...